Surface functionalization

Surface functionalization introduces chemical functional groups to a surface. This way, functional materials can be designed from substrates with standard bulk material properties. Prominent examples can be found in semiconductor industry and biomaterial research. In both cases, plasma processing technologies were successfully employed.
